From May 22 to June 12, 2024, Isle of Man Airport saw a significant rise in passenger traffic, with a total of 60,163 passengers passed through, with 30,027 arrivals and 30,136 departures.
This marks a 7% increase compared to the same period in 2023, which saw 56,039 passengers (28,055 arrivals and 27,984 departures).
This represents a 46% increase over 2022 figures, though the Airport still acknowledge’s it is still 18% below 2019 numbers.
This growth includes all passengers on scheduled flights, general aviation, and private jets.

Gary Cobb, Airport Director, shared his enthusiasm: “We are incredibly pleased with the strong passenger numbers during this year’s TT period.
“This success is a testament to the hard work and dedication of the entire airport team and excellent cooperation with the airlines. I want to extend my heartfelt thanks to everyone involved for their unwavering commitment to providing exceptional service during this busy period.”
The busiest day was June 3, with 4,383 passengers handled.
